  11. Not sure if there is an Everton thread. The main bowl of the ground is fantastic, truly brilliant views and the atmosphere was superb. Certainly a fitting theatre for a test match. There are a fair few things to sort out though. The signage was poor, almost apologetic. Fine if you go there week in week out, unnecessarily difficult if you are going as a one off. The toilet blocks are poorly designed and seemed extremely inadequate, leading to some fairly ugly scenes where I was of enormous queues and people getting very angry with people who were trying to push in. I can't believe there would be so little stewarding and crowd support for a football match and that hasn't helped. The transport has been absolutely tragic getting to and from Warrington, and as I write from Lime Street it still looks like a warzone with a series of tiny trains leaving with barely half the people who wanted to get on managing to. Considering Northern Trains are supposedly a major partner of RFL, it's embarrassing how unprepared they are. It's been a good day but unnecessarily painful.
